>Let me explain:
>In editiplus I you have a cliptext library tab (part of the GUI) when 
>you open up the correct cliptext library (e.g phpcode) you see all the 
>labels for your fragments of code. You put so much in there you ofter 
>have to search it.
>e.g I might be inserting a text box into a webpage and I know one of
>my fragments had some style sheet code in there. So I would look up
>"text" and all my cliptext library entries starting with "text" can be
>toggled through. I then find the "text box - style sheet"  entry
>double click it and it inserts the code into the editor at the cursor
>position. With Geany's snippets you actually have to remember the
>keyboard entry to have it inserted. This won't work because there are
>literally hundreds of entries and you memory is jogged by looking them
>up and then inserting them.

I see your point but it's just not (yet) implemented. Maybe someone
wants to write code for such an interface, ideally as a plugin.
